We have an Akita Rescue and have purchased and used many different types of crates. Not one crate is a one-size-fits all and despite negative reviews wehre people have said their dog destroyed the soft crate, that is not the crate's fault - it is an education issue in that a soft crate should not be used to crate train a dog in. A good quality wire-crate is usually best for that. We have used the soft crates before to give a crate trained dog a time-out or for traveling, such as if we want to contain a dog in a hotel room. The other brand of soft crate we have is the NozToNoz "Sof-Krate". The cost of the N2N as compared to this one is about the same, when comparing the same size, but there is a substantial difference of quality. The NozToNoz also has 3 doors - a large side door, an end door, and a top "moon roof" door. We liked that the N2N had one semii-canvas panel on the one of the long sides. The weight is about the same but the N2N felt just a wee bit lighter weight. The sturdiness as compared side by side is no comparison. The frame on the N2N is way firmer, and the canvas cover on the N2N stretches tightly across the frame. While some people may like the attached pouches, that was not something that was important to us, but we did find, that the Elite Field has WAY too many straps and things hanging. Why would you have a carrying strap on a crate that is designed to hold a dog up to 90lbs? Also, the N2N had a thick rubbery bottom which had a hard/yet spongy/non-slip nubby texture to it, rather than the thin black rubber bottom on the Elite. Also, the black rubber bottom on the N2N went all the way around, like wainscoating, and we appreciated that feature. Returned this item. Dollar for Dollar, same size compared, in our professional opinion, we think the N2N is a better value. Easy to Open/Close. Very Convenient for Travel
I occasionally travel by car with my English Cocker Spaniel. His breeder recommends a hard-sided kennel for travel in the car (for safety) but suggested also getting a soft-sided, collapsible crate to take into hotel rooms, etc. It's MUCH easier than lugging the awkward hard-sided crate through the hotel.Initially I purchased the 30" EliteField crate, but it was too large for my 25 lb. dog. I exchanged it for the 24" version and it's the perfect size. The crate is a very manageable weight, even for an old fogie like me. And it comes with a zippered case with a detachable carry strap. The crate unfolds very simply and quickly, and the mechanism for locking the frame in place is easy to use. I'd previously purchased a different model from another company and it was incredibly difficult to lock the frame open, and even more difficult to UNLOCK it and collapse it back down. The EliteField crate is much, much easier to use.The canvas sides are sturdy and look like they'll stand up to a lot of use. Corners are reinforced with another layer of canvas. There's a zippered pocket built into the top of the crate. A nice place to stash poopy bags, a leash, etc. And it doesn't interfere with the crate when it's folded up and put into the carry bag. There's a second zippered, canvas accessories bag attached by snaps to the back side, if you need additional storage. The included dog bed is an added bonus, and it's nice that the crate can be easily folded with the bed inside.I also like that all four sides of the crate are mesh so my dog can see out from any directions. (If your dog digs at the sides of the crate, I would not recommend a soft-sided crate like this. The mesh windows could be shredded easily.) The two larger mesh sides can be unzipped and used as an entrance, although only one of those entrances has a velcro strap to keep the door open. The canvas top also zips open so you can put the dog into the crate from top down if you prefer that.I am very pleased with the EliteField crate. I've attached a photo of my English Cocker sitting next to the crate. He weighs 25 lbs and is 22" tall from floor to the top of his head. I think the 24" crate would be the perfect size for most cockers, beagles, dachshunds, and similarly sized dogs. I have a second English Cocker Spaniel who is much closer in size to a Springer Spaniel. He doesn't travel with me, but if he did, he would definitely need the larger 30" crate.

It collapses and sets up easy and comes with a protective travel carrier
So far I am a fan of this crate. It is so lightweight compared to the full metal crate! It collapses and sets up easy and comes with a protective travel carrier. It's perfect for when we travel. The mesh is thicker than I was expecting, which is a definite plus. Of course, with any "soft crate" you need to know what type of dog you have. If you have a puppy/dog who chews or a dog that claws when confined, a soft crate probably isn't the best pick for you period. The storage compartments are also a little bonus. I prefer to use the large opening for my dog, but I like that it also has one on top and on the more narrow side. Here is a photos of my 52lb dog in the 36"Lx24"Wx28"H crate. As you can see it is rather spacious, especially since he tends to curl up on one side. Personally I wouldn't go any smaller for him because I want him to be able to stretch out or stand without the top being open....but I easily could have gotten the next size down and just kept the top open.
